Problem Statement

#490 floored a fixed inventory of indirection wrappers (sudo/env/xargs/time/nohup/timeout/nice, plus find/fd carrying a per-result exec flag) to at least ask, so an inner command cannot ride a permissive allow on the wrapper text. That inventory was seeded from a fixed list; any exec-capable tool outside it can still launder a payload under a permissive allow — the fail-safe floor is only as good as its inventory (#575). This issue surveys other modern core-tool rewrites and parallelizers that run an inner command per input or as a subcommand, and extends the wrapper sets with the exec-capable ones.

Background

The relevant code all lives in src/access-intent/bash/command-enumeration.ts:

  • INDIRECTION_WRAPPER_NAMES: Set<string> — always-invoke wrappers floored by command-name basename alone.
  • EXEC_CONDITIONAL_WRAPPERS: Map<string, ReadonlySet<string>> — search tools (find/fd) floored only when an exec flag is present.
  • classifyWrapperCommand(node) — reads a command node's basename + args, returns "indirection" for a member of INDIRECTION_WRAPPER_NAMES, or for a EXEC_CONDITIONAL_WRAPPERS tool carrying a matching exec flag.
  • The BashCommand.wrapperKind discriminant flows to WRAPPER_SENTINEL in src/handlers/gates/bash-command.ts, where resolveBashCommandCheck floors an allow up to ask and stamps the <indirection-bash-wrapper> review-log pattern.

Per the #490 retro, the floor half needs no code change once the classifier emits "indirection" — the WRAPPER_SENTINEL map already has the indirection key, and the advisory surface (resolveBashAdvisoryCheck) reuses the shared resolveBashCommandCheck, so the floor applies to both the gate and the advisory answer for free. The entire change is therefore: add 8 strings to one Set, plus tests and docs.

Design Overview

Survey results

Each candidate was checked against the criterion "does it run an inner command per input or as a subcommand?"

Adopt into INDIRECTION_WRAPPER_NAMES (always-invoke; floored by basename):

Tool Why it execs
parallel GNU parallel: runs a command per input line (like xargs).
rust-parallel Rust parallel/xargs rewrite; runs commands from stdin/args/:::.
rush shenwei356/rush: Go parallel command runner (like GNU parallel/gargs).
doas OpenBSD sudo rewrite; runs a mandatory command as another user.
setsid Runs a following command in a new session.
stdbuf Runs a following COMMAND with modified stream buffering.
watch Executes a command periodically.
flock flock <file> <cmd> wraps a lock around command execution.

Reject (not exec-capable — no per-result or subcommand exec):

Tool Why rejected
sad Batch file search-and-replace (a sed alternative); edits files, execs nothing.
fselect SQL-like file search; its interactive "queries" are internal, no per-result subcommand.
runiq Line dedupe filter; execs nothing.
gargs Exec-capable, but declined this round (see Non-Goals).

Notes on the adopted set:

  • All parse as flat command nodes with the inner command visible as arguments, identical to the existing env/nice/timeout entries — so basename flooring is correct and no per-wrapper option-arity table is needed.
  • rust-parallel contains a hyphen; basename("rust-parallel") returns the whole string and matches the set entry exactly (basename only splits on /).
  • flock has a bare-fd form (flock <number>) that runs no command; basename flooring over-floors that rare shell-script form to ask. This is the accepted least-privilege posture, consistent with #490's accepted edge that a bare env/sudo -l is floored too.
  • parallel/rust-parallel/rush take options and templates but always invoke a command; there is no bare read-only mode to preserve (unlike find/fd), so they are always-invoke, not exec-conditional.

Risks and Mitigations

  • Risk: over-flooring a legitimate non-exec form (e.g. flock <fd>, watch-less usage). Mitigation: accepted least-privilege posture, consistent with #490's bare-env/sudo -l edge; an allow is only clamped to ask (a prompt), never denied, so the user retains one keypress to proceed.
  • Risk: a hyphenated command name (rust-parallel) not matching. Mitigation: basename splits only on /, so rust-parallel matches the set entry verbatim; a classifier test row pins it.
  • Risk: the enumerated docs drifting from the code set. Mitigation: the doc-update step edits configuration.md and the package skill in the same change; the pre-completion reviewer checks documentation staleness.
